Transaction af28983f10d8e475d2725c1fd5e3e5e77115b91a5ad5c9480e76c2c19f3f7fa6
1 Input
2 Outputs
- af28983f10d8e475d2725c1fd5e3e5e77115b91a5ad5c9480e76c2c19f3f7fa6:0
- af28983f10d8e475d2725c1fd5e3e5e77115b91a5ad5c9480e76c2c19f3f7fa6:1
value 664072
address 15Lww5skekjrUyCaSV7XpMMyPiF4sichZT
value 34711406
address 1ECTGNHkHwX7HCXfY2brnRM6tUEAtS7cGv